[quote=Anonymous] Older than most on this board, and as the old woman, chiming in to say yes, this was inappropriate in a big way. He may never do it again; he may have had too much to drink (which is NOT an excuse but only an explanation); he may even not [i]think[/i] of it as hitting on you, may be a touchy-feely-huggy guy ....BUT it's still a red flag. A worse one, too, because he'd already made you into an emotional confidante about his divorce, OP. He's not your old friend. He's [i]a parent you really only know through your kid[/i]. His making you into a confidante on whom he can pour thoughts and feelings about his divorce was [i]inappropriate even before the thigh touching[/i]. Do not be where you're alone with him, and "alone" includes conversations at the sidelines of the kids' activity or conversations in restaurants where the group's there but he's trying to chat to you in asides. Keep your kid and his kid friends, because the kid likely needs support and friendship amid the divorce, but arrange any meet-ups through the mom. Tell your DH what happened, for sure, if you have not already. Keep it direct and simple and note that the guy has been talking about the divorce and that this blindsided you. Tell DH (before he can ask it) that you are not going to listen to any more of the guy's divorce talk and will have DH do more of the activity stuff with your child. Note that if other parents at the travel event saw this guy touch you, it may get back to your DH and you want him to hear if from you, not from someone else. [/quote]
